Mild hyperbaric therapy offers a promising alternative to traditional methods. It operates at a lower pressure than standard hyperbaric chambers. This unique approach enhances safety, making it more accessible for various health concerns.
Many people are concerned about the potential side effects of traditional hyperbaric therapy. Mild hyperbaric therapy significantly reduces these risks. The lower pressure can decrease the likelihood of barotrauma, which can occur during treatment. Patients often report a more comfortable experience. This can lead to increased compliance with therapy, making it a viable option for long-term health improvement.
However, not all mild hyperbaric devices are the same. It’s crucial to ensure that the chamber meets safety standards. Engaging with a professional who understands the nuances of the therapy can guide you through your options. As with any health-related decision, thorough research and consultation are essential. Mild hyperbaric therapy is gaining traction in sports and rehabilitation arenas. Athletes are increasingly turning to this therapy to boost performance and speed up recovery. It involves breathing pure oxygen in a controlled environment. This process can enhance oxygen delivery to tissues, promoting faster healing.
Rehabilitation specialists report noticeable improvements in healing times. For instance, athletes who use mild hyperbaric chambers often experience reduced muscle soreness. They can return to training sooner after injuries. The therapy is also beneficial for chronic conditions like joint pain or inflammation. Patients observe enhanced mobility and decreased discomfort.
While the results are promising, it’s essential to approach treatment with realistic expectations. Not everyone will experience the same benefits. Some may find the effects minimal or slow to manifest. It’s crucial to integrate this therapy into a broader recovery plan that includes physical therapy and rest.
